2004 Toyota Celsior 4.3 C specification Specs


OVERVIEW

With a fuel consumption of 21 mpg US - 25.2 mpg UK - 11.2 L/100km, a weight of 4012 lbs (1820 kg), the Toyota Celsior 4.3 C specification has a V-type 8 cylinder DOHC engine, a High octane premium gasoline engine 3UZ-FE. This engine 3UZ-FE produces a maximum power of 283.8 PS (280 bhp - 208.7 kW) at 5600 rpm and a maximum torque of 429.5 Nm (316.8 lb.ft - 43.8 kg.m) at 3400 rpm. The engine power is transmitted to the road by the rear wheel drive (FR) with a 6AT gearbox. For stopping power, the Toyota Celsior 4.3 C specification braking system includes Ventilated disk at the rear and Ventilated disk at the front. Stock tire sizes are 225/55 on 17 inch rims 95W at the rear and 225/55 on 17 inch rims 95W at the front. Chassis details - Toyota Celsior 4.3 C specification has double wishbone air spring rear suspension and double wishbone air spring front suspension for road holding and ride confort.

The standard wheel size for the Celsior 4.3 C specification is typically 17 inches in diameter. These wheels are designed to provide a comfortable and smooth ride while maintaining responsive handling characteristics on various road surfaces.

The tires fitted to the Celsior 4.3 C are typically sized at 225/55 R17 95W. These specifications indicate that the tire width is 225 mm, the aspect ratio is 55 (indicating the sidewall height as a percentage of the tire's width), and the R signifies radial construction. The number 17 represents the wheel diameter in inches, and the 95W indicates the tire's load-carrying capacity and speed rating.
